Output b5258059f4e293ba70b4c3f27a798653612981b7dcebdb3c96badbce8636bdaa:8

value
261756222
script pubkey
OP_HASH160 OP_PUSHBYTES_20 db685785bf58a278e567a42268784812389f3eb9 OP_EQUAL
address
3Mh8uMbLwTNnVo9M8ZUX1YkN9DB6Y6aoti
transaction
b5258059f4e293ba70b4c3f27a798653612981b7dcebdb3c96badbce8636bdaa
spent
true